Beef Mustard Curry Sri Lankan Style

    Ingredients:
    500 gms Top side or Rump steak Beef cut in to cubes
    Chillie powder - 3 Tea spoons
    Saffron - 1 Tea spoon
    Coriander raw powder - 1 Tea Spoon
    Cumin Powder - 1 Tea Spoon
    Mustard Seeds ground - 2 Tea spoons
    Vegetable Oil - 5 Tea Spoons
    Salt to taste
    Pepper Powder - 1 Tea spoon
    Onion - Large sliced
    Green Chillies - 2 fresh chopped
    Garlic - 3 Pips - Chopped
    Ginger - small piece fresh chopped
    Lemon Grass - if available chopped
    Tomato paste - 2 Tea Spoons
    Lime Juice - 3 Tea Spoons
    Any milk use - 1/2 to 1 cup
    Curry leaves - 5 (optional)

    Method:
    Add all ingredients in to the beef cubes except the lime juice mustard and milk (To be added later).

    Mix all together and cook in a slow fire for about 15 minutes. Then add 1/2 a cup of water and leave to cook for another 10 minutes.

    Now add the lime juice, mustard and milk and cook for a further 10 minutes until the meat is well absorbed with the gravy.

    Ready to serve with rice for 4 people.
